Micro:bit expansion module designed for IoT projects. The board is equipped with WiFi, two-channel output for DC motors, 6 IO pins, I2C interface, UART, buzzer, 3 RGB LEDs and a charging circuit. The module is powered by a CR123A battery (not included). To guarantee the appropriate level of safety, the board is protected against short-circuit and reverse connection.
